Abstract

A field experiment was conducted to study the effect of nutrient management modules on wheat (Triticum aestivum L.)-(‘NW 1014′) yield and quality at students instructional farm, Narendra Deva University of Agriculture and Technology, Narendra Nagar, Ayodhya during winter season (rabi) of 2014–15 and 2015–16. The experimental soil was silty loam having organic carbon 3.4 g/kg with pH 8.38, available N 170.50, P 11.80 and K 215.50 kg/ha, S 6.10 and Zn 0.38 ppm. The experiment consisted of 14 treatments, viz. T1, RDF (150:60:40 kg/ha N, P2O5 and K2O); T2, RDF + 20 kg ZnSO4/ha; T3, RDF + 5 t FYM/ha; T4, RDF + 2.5 t VC/ha; T5, RDF + 5 t FYM + 20 kg ZnSO4/ha; T6, RDF + 2.5 t VC + 20 kg ZnSO4/ha; T7, 75% RDF; T8, 75% RDF + 20 kg ZnSO4/ha; T9, 75% RDF + 10 t FYM/ha; T10, 75% RDF + 5 t VC/ha; T11, 75% RDF + 10 t FYM + 20 kg ZnSO4/ha; T12, 75% RDF + 5 t VC + 20 kg ZnSO4/ha; T13, 125% RDF; T14, 125% RDF + 20 kg ZnSO4/ha. Pooled analysis revealed that the application of 100% recommended dose of fertilizer (RDF) + vermicompost at 2.5 t/ha + ZnSO4 at 20 kg/ha recorded highest grain yield (4.91 t/ha), straw yield (6.75 t/ha) and protein content (11.71%) followed by 100% RDF + FYM at 5 t/ha + ZnSO4 at 20 kg/ha. Similar trend was also noted in soil properties after wheat harvest.
